Atty. Mark Friedlander
Mark Friedlander is a lawyer practicing taxation, litigation. Mark received a B.A. degree from Brooklyn College of the City University of New York in 1965, and has been licensed for 57 years.
Profile Summary
About Mark Friedlander at a glance
Mark Friedlander is a Supm. Ct. Jus. based in Bronx, New York. They have 57+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1969. Their practice focuses on tax and litigation. Admitted to practice in New York (1969), U.S. District Courts, Southern and Eastern Districts of New York, U.S. Court of Appeals, Second Circ (1977), U.S. Supreme Court (1982), and U.S. Court of Appeals for the Armed Forces (1993). Educated at Harvard Law School (J.D. New, 1968) and Brooklyn College of the City University of New York (B.A., 1965). Serves clients in Bronx, NY and the surrounding metropolitan area.
